For isocratic determinations of monosaccharides, disaccharides, and linear polysaccharides in a variety of matrices, use the rugged Thermo Scientifica, c Dionexa, c CarboPaca, c Pa1 analytical & Guard Columns. This specialized anion-exchange column, combined with pulsed amperometric detection (PaD), delivers high-resolution separations. The unique Thermo Scientifica, c Dionexa, c MicroBeada, c pellicular structure of the Dionex CarboPac Pa1 resin gives it stability from pH 0-14 at all concentrations of buffer salts. The pellicular resin structure provides excellent mass transfer resulting in fast gradient re-equilibration.

For sensitive, rugged, and reliable separations of reduced sugars without the need for derivatization, use Thermo Scientific(TM) Dionex(TM) CarboPac(TM) MA1 Analytical & Guard Columns. These high-capacity, strong anion-exchange columns efficiently separate reduced monosaccharides and disaccharides commonly found in food products and physiological samples. Achieve baseline resolution of fucose, N-acetyl-(D)-glucosamine, N-acetyl-galactosamine, mannose, glucose, galactose, and neutral oligosaccharides in the same separation. Diameter (Metric):4mm; Flow Rate: 0.2 to 0.5mL/min;Max. Pressure:2000psi;Mobile Phase Compatibility:Incompatible with solvents and anionic detergent; Hydroxide eluents only; Particle Size:7.5um;pH: 0-14
